Fifty years of the Egrem recording label

Matrices of recordings by Benny Moré, Celeste Mendoza, Elena Burke and countless figures of Cuban music are kept jealously in the archives of the Egrem, the label that for half a century has treasured these and other models, which then have turned into fabulous phonograms.

“More than seventy thousand,” Mario Escalona, director of the music publisher said to disclose the details of the promotional campaign for the company to celebrate these 50 years, which will marked next March 31.

The global strategy designed by the label to present the artists of its extensive catalog is interesting. The initiative encompasses both artists who are part of their archives, as the musicians who lead an active life in the scene. To achieve this Egrem is headed in the positioning in Internet of new and already established artists, as Escalona said.

“More than a company, Egrem is a cultural value that encloses all the work we do to disseminate such works,” the manager said.

Concerts, tribute galas made by prominent dance groups, album releases, sponsorship of events related to the music, and the reissue of the record prize granted to their most outstanding musical productions, appearing in the intense celebration which will extend to the summer months.

Among the albums that will expand the repertoire of this year stands Egrem 50th Anniversary DVD collection containing five CDs with the memory of this half century of the label. Also they will release a three CD compilation featuring its best-selling discs and albums and DVD’s made of figures as Eliades Ochoa, Arsenio Rodríguez, Merceditas Valdes, Chucho Valdes and the Santiaguero Septet, among others.

The La Colmenita ‘s concert last Sunday at the Karl Marx theater, will give way to Egrem tributes rendered by prestigious companies such as Danza Contemporánea de Cuba , the National Ballet of Cuba , the National Symphony Orchestra, the Lyric Theatre and the Liszt Alfonso National Ballet.

The public can also enjoy concerts by Buena Fe, Karamba , Waldo Mendoza, Elain Morales, Raul Paz and Virulo, organized in a timeline that starts just this month and end in August.

The organization of festivals related to the various musical genres is another objective of the label, hence we will see its mark on the Piña Colada of Ciego de Ávila, the Guillermo Barreto in memoriam Drum festival and Jazz Plaza, both in the capital , Musicology Prize – organized by Casa de las Américas , and La Rampa Art Fair , also in Havana.

A new website, the declaration of Radio Progreso station as spokesperson for the festivities, and the presentation of new institutional catalog by Egrem, become imminent actions of the label to celebrate its birthday in the month of March.
